
0750_PAMF_CLE Cohort 10_Applying DEI Principles to Leadership
Description:
Inclusive workplace cultures are vital in healthcare, where diverse perspectives enhance patient care and team collaboration. This workshop will help learners foster an environment where every team member feels valued, heard, and empowered. Focusing on a growth mindset and psychological safety, the session will explore how these elements drive trust, adaptability, and innovation. Learners will increase their self-awareness of biases, including similarity bias, and learn strategies to create a culture rooted in trust and inclusivity. Through interactive learning, they will gain practical tools to lead inclusively, promoting a workplace were diverse ideas and experiences fuel growth and resilience.

Learning Objectives
1. Discuss the definition of a growth mindset and articulate its significance in healthcare.
2. Explain the connection between a growth mindset and its potential to enhance workplace inclusion.
3. Integrate practical approaches to nurture a growth mindset and inclusivity within healthcare teams.
4. Participate in case-study discussions, dissecting and analyzing how growth mindset principles can be applied in real-world healthcare scenarios.
5. Recall the definition of psychological safety and its relevance in healthcare.
